More Stories Huey Tells
Huey has a hard time being little brother to Julian. Julian is bigger and bolder and more confident, and he likes to push Huey around. But Huey is smart, with a mind of his own.
When Julian won't let Huey use his brand-new basketball, Huey figures out how to make Julian share it. When Huey thinks flowers he planted are sick, he's ready to take Julian's radio, and a whole lot of other stuff, to cure them. When he realizes their dad's smoking is bad for his health, he teams up with Julian to try to persuade their dad to stop. And when Huey and Julian get together with friends to look for buried treasure, Huey's willing to be the one to go down to the bottom of a mine they've dug. Maybe too willing--because the mine starts crumbling, and smart as Huey is, he can't figure any way to get out.
